And in return (and moving it over to thechat), here's some info about
the 1st implementation of rfc1149 (CPIP - IP by Carrier Pigeon)

http://www.blug.linux.no/rfc1149/writeup.html

They got four ping replys, with ping times varying from 3211 to 6389 seconds
using a 7.5 minute interval between ping packets.

Engineering on the edge, folks.
